Printbase paper serves as the foundational substrate for laminates, acting as a canvas for decorative coatings and finishes. Its quality directly impacts the final product's visual appeal, strength, and functionality. When considering printbase paper, factors such as opacity, absorbency, surface smoothness, and compatibility with various coatings must be thoroughly assessed. Each of these attributes plays a vital role in achieving a high-quality laminate that meets end-user expectations.

What Are the Key Factors to Consider When Selecting Printbase Paper?
When evaluating printbase paper for laminates, consider the following seven critical factors:
- **Opacity**: High opacity ensures that the underlying substrate does not show through, providing a vibrant and consistent finish. This is particularly important for decorative applications where aesthetics are paramount.
- **Absorbency**: A paper with optimal absorbency allows for better adhesion of coatings, enhancing the laminate's durability and reducing the risk of delamination over time.
- **Surface Smoothness**: A smooth surface promotes better print quality and finish appearance, vital for decorative laminates used in high-end furniture and fixtures.
- **Weight and Thickness**: The weight and thickness of the printbase paper influence its handling during processing and the overall weight of the finished product. Selecting the appropriate specifications can enhance production efficiency.
- **Compatibility with Coatings**: Ensuring that the printbase paper is compatible with the intended coating technology—be it solid color coating or PE coating—is essential for achieving optimal performance and longevity.
- **Environmental Considerations**: Sourcing sustainable materials is increasingly important in today’s market. Consideration of eco-friendly options can enhance brand reputation and appeal to environmentally conscious consumers.
- **Cost-Effectiveness**: While quality should not be compromised for price, it is crucial to find a balance that aligns with budget constraints while still ensuring high-performance outcomes.
